TFT (Thin Film Transistor) color LCD monitor
The type of LCD monitor used in this camera. TFT panels provide good resolution and excellent
responsiveness.

White Balance

The light emitted by fluorescent tubes or incandescent light bulbs differs slightly in color. Without any
adjustment, the colors in shots taken under such light sources differ from the actual colors you see. For this
reason, a white subject is used as a reference to adjust the colors before shooting so that the resulting photo
shows the actual colors of the subject.
Zooming
This refers to the gradual changing of the photography scale. Gradual enlargement of the subject is called
"zooming in", while gradual reduction of the subject is called "zooming out".
